The poor health of people in Africa impedes the economic development of the continent enormously. In Biovision’s projects, this problem is tackled, together with those affected, in a sustainable way:
Every year around 2 million people die from malaria-most of them in sub-Saharan Africa. Malaria is one of the greatest obstacles to development in Africa. All prevention methods, including control of breeding sites, training and distribution of mosquito nets should lead to long-term protection of the people from malaria.
